Output e374fb9dd39a5ab9f24ab3385346d023e41f21e14d04fa2793df48655668a079:5

value
42152944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c5fbc2177dd4e21325b83371fddbeec3fc27b75 OP_EQUAL
address
3D2eQ7As1tUWZzDDjrzWHQoD4SM8y9BzMR
transaction
e374fb9dd39a5ab9f24ab3385346d023e41f21e14d04fa2793df48655668a079
spent
true